New beeping sound
Driving through Roanoke Virginia today when a never before heard beeping began...high pitched and muted in volume...i began checking the dash gauges and for any warning lights. All were normal. After 10 seconds or so the beeping stopped! This occurred 3 more times on the drive and never lasted long enough to narrow down location of the sound. I did notice we were climbing in elevation and frost was accumulated on the road side and rooftops. So my question now is whether my classic 2015 has a freeze alarm built in?

Yep!...she began the beeping again today. I was noticing the snow building up on the roadside and right on cue ,the beep started. I quickly swapped the Navi out of navigation mode and into Sirius radio mode...there I saw the blinking snowflake icon and "ice warning" written in red! Just a few seconds later it all cleared...I learn something new every day!
